Solar Attic Fans: Eco-Friendly and Cost-Effective
The technology behind modern solar attic fans has advanced significantly, with current models featuring high-efficiency photovoltaic panels that operate effectively even in partial sunlight conditions. Many units include battery backup systems that provide continued operation during cloudy periods or evening hours when attic heat buildup remains problematic. For WA residents, solar attic fans qualify for federal tax credits of up to 30% of installation costs, and some utility companies offer additional rebates for energy-efficient home improvements.
Professional Grade Systems
Modern electric attic fans feature variable speed controls, humidity sensors, and programmable thermostats that optimize performance based on real-time attic conditions. These smart controls ensure the fan operates only when needed, minimizing electricity consumption while maximizing cooling benefits. For WA homeowners, the operating costs of electric attic fans typically range from $30-$50 annually, depending on local electricity rates and usage patterns, representing minimal ongoing expense for significant comfort and energy savings benefits.
